The Allure of Marbella’s Coastline

Stretching over 27 kilometers along the Costa del Sol, Marbella’s coastline is lined with more than 20 distinct beaches, each with its own personality. From lively social scenes to quiet, untouched shores, the variety is unmatched. Many beaches, like Playa de la Fontanilla and Playa de Nagüeles, hold the prestigious Blue Flag award—an international symbol of water quality, safety, and eco-friendly services.

Exploring the Best Beaches in Marbella

Playa de Nagüeles: Luxury Living on the Golden Mile

Positioned along Marbella’s iconic Golden Mile, Playa de Nagüeles is where luxury meets the sea. With golden sands, clear waters, and a curated selection of upscale beach clubs like Marbella Club and Trocadero, this beach is synonymous with prestige.

Living here places you among some of Marbella’s most sought-after real estate, including luxury villas, penthouses with sea views, and gated communities. Prices are premium, but so is the lifestyle.

Playa del Alicate: Family-Friendly and Tranquil

East of Marbella’s center lies Playa del Alicate, a quieter, residential beach that’s favored by families and long-term residents. It’s known for its soft sand, shallow waters, and peaceful atmosphere—making it a wonderful choice for those seeking a more laid-back coastal experience.

The real estate in this area includes mid-range villas, townhouses, and frontline apartments. It’s a zone where rental yields are steady but where many owners also choose to reside year-round.

Cabopino Beach and the Artola Dunes: Natural Beauty and Bohemian Vibes

Cabopino Beach, adjacent to the protected Artola dunes, is one of Marbella’s most ecologically unique areas. This stretch offers a softer, natural vibe with sand dunes, pine forests, and a low-rise marina setting.

Property buyers here are often nature lovers or those drawn to the more artistic, bohemian side of the Costa del Sol. Investment opportunities include townhouses, beachside apartments, and smaller villas, ideal for short-term holiday rentals.

Playa de la Fontanilla: Heart of Marbella Living

Right in Marbella’s town center, Playa de la Fontanilla is a vibrant, accessible beach perfect for daily life. The promenade—Paseo Marítimo—is lined with cafes, shops, and restaurants, creating an active beach scene year-round.

This is one of the best locations for investors targeting city-meets-sea convenience. Properties range from compact apartments to modern penthouses, often commanding strong rental returns thanks to walkability and central appeal.

Puerto Banús Beach: Glamour and Global Appeal

No list of Marbella’s beaches would be complete without mentioning Puerto Banús. Known for its luxury yachts, high-end retail, and elite social scene, the beach here attracts international visitors and high-net-worth individuals year after year.

Property in Puerto Banús is among the most expensive in Marbella, with beachfront apartments, designer penthouses, and luxury villas that offer both capital appreciation and outstanding short-term rental demand.

How to Buy Property Near Marbella’s Beaches: A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1: Define Your Purpose and Ideal Location

Before making any purchase, it’s crucial to clarify your goals. Are you buying for personal enjoyment, long-term investment, or short-term rental income? Your answer will shape the beach zone best suited for you. For example, investors might prioritize Puerto Banús, while families could lean toward Playa del Alicate.

Step 2: Prepare Your Budget and Understand Financing Options

Non-residents in Spain can access mortgages from Spanish banks, usually up to 60–70% of the property value. It’s best to have a clear understanding of taxes, fees, and financing terms from the outset. KLB Homes helps buyers navigate these financial requirements with trusted local partners.

Step 3: Engage a Local Lawyer for Legal Due Diligence

Legal security is key. A local bilingual lawyer will check for zoning restrictions, building licenses, and community regulations—especially important for beachfront properties subject to Spain’s Coastal Law.

Step 4: Reserve the Property and Sign Contracts

Once you’ve selected a property, you’ll typically start with a reservation contract and payment of a fee (usually between €6,000–€10,000). This is followed by a private purchase contract, which secures your purchase with a 10% deposit.

Step 5: Finalize the Sale at the Notary

Be Aware of the Challenges—and How to Manage Them

As with any investment, there are risks to consider. Coastal property may face limitations under Spain’s strict environmental and coastal protection laws, especially for renovations or new builds. Maintenance costs are also higher due to exposure to salt air and humidity.

Where to Invest: Top Beachside Neighborhoods

The Golden Mile

Arguably the most iconic address in Marbella, the Golden Mile connects the town center with Puerto Banús. It’s an elite stretch known for exclusivity, five-star resorts, and spectacular sea views. Perfect for high-end buyers.

Elviria and East Marbella

An elegant suburb filled with pine forests, golf resorts, and beach clubs like Nikki Beach. Elviria is ideal for families or investors wanting great amenities without the ultra-high price tag of central Marbella.

San Pedro de Alcántara

San Pedro offers more space, lower prices, and a rising appeal. Its wide beach promenade and family-friendly vibe attract expats and long-term renters. Properties here offer good value with upside potential.

Cabopino and Artola

A pocket of peace and nature. With limited development and environmental protections, this area offers a niche market for sustainable-minded buyers.

FAQs: Investing Near Marbella’s Beaches

1. Are beachfront properties in Marbella worth the premium?
Yes, beachfront homes in Marbella consistently show higher appreciation and rental income compared to inland alternatives, especially in high-demand zones like the Golden Mile.

2. Can foreign buyers easily purchase beachfront real estate in Spain?
Absolutely. The process is straightforward with the right guidance. You’ll need a tax identification number (NIE), a Spanish bank account, and legal representation—services we assist with at KLB Homes.

3. What’s the best beach area for families relocating to Marbella?
Playa del Alicate and Elviria are top choices for families, offering calm waters, residential communities, and strong local infrastructure like international schools.

4. Do I need a rental license for short-term beach rentals?
Yes. Andalusia requires a license for short-term lets. Our team helps buyers secure the right permits and understand their responsibilities as landlords.

5. How do I know if a beachside property is legally compliant?
